Who funds Pet Rescue Solutions

EIN 46-2411550 · El Monte, CA · NTEE D99

Pet Rescue Solutions of El Monte, CA (EIN 46-2411550) was named as a grant recipient by 4 funders in 5 grants paid totaling $19,079 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
